NHS WEST SUFFOLK CLINICAL COMMISSIONING GROUP
Care Home and Domiciliary Care Market Review
Suffolk County Council, Ipswich & East Suffolk and West Suffolk CCGs (the partners) are reviewing their commissioning strategies for care homes (residential and nursing) and domiciliary care.
In order to make informed decisions about forward plans and to ensure services are fit for the future there is a need to bring together market intelligence to ensure that the commissioned services are sustainable, of the right quality and affordable.
To this end a jointly commissioned, time-limited Strategic Market Review to inform the future market development strategy is to be undertaken.
The partners are looking to commission an organisation who has experience of delivering whole system market reviews, particularly within care markets, which draw together analysis of qualitative and quantitative market and commissioner information and data, direct engagement with stakeholders and desktop research.
The partners will be using this review to inform their future commissioning decisions and as such will be looking for organisations that deploy a robust methodology which will deliver the outcomes required.
The care market is complex and rapidly evolving and therefore the partners are looking to commission an organisation who can evidence that they understand the market and have delivered research within this field before.
If your organisation is interested in delivering this distinct piece of work please email Jane Garnett on the contact details enclosed prior to the 18th March 2016.
The partners will be looking to understand and be reassured that providers understand the requirement and are capable of delivery prior to commissioning any organisation(s).
More information regarding the requirements of this review is included in the attachment within this advert.
